Understanding Long-Term Addiction Rehab

Long term drug treatment will provide you with a safe and conducive setting where you can focus on resolving your substance abuse and addiction. This means that you will be isolated from your peers, home, and any other situation that could possibly cause you to start abusing drugs and drinking alcohol again.

During your time in treatment, you will also learn how to pursue rehabilitation and recovery by developing the coping mechanisms and recovery methods that will support your sobriety and abstinence long after you complete your treatment.

Even though you may be concerned that you will be away from your everyday lifestyle for such a long time, consider the many research findings that promote long-term drug and alcohol treatment and you will agree that the time spent in one of these programs will be well worth it.

How Long-Term Rehab Works

In most cases, long-term substance abuse treatment is designed to help you overcome your substance abuse by effectively detoxing your body and mind of all the intoxicating and mind-altering substances you have been ingesting.

These programs can also help by preparing you on how to deal with any triggers that could potentially prompt you to relapse. As such, you may find that this form of rehabilitation will effectively enable you to develop the recovery methods that will vital when you must to hold on to your sobriety and abstain from drugs when confronted by tempting circumstances.

Today, there are also high end, private rehabilitation facilities that provide resort-like amenities, environments, and services. Choosing this type of lavish program could potentially make it easier for you to battle your addiction.

However, if you lack the finances to afford these programs, you should not despair. Even a low-cost drug rehabilitation facility in Bend, TX. can be effective if you stay in it for a long time until you are completely in charge of your life and no longer addicted to drugs and/or alcohol.

Moreover, most long-term treatment programs will provide you with 24 hour care, supervision, and maintenance by a group of highly trained, knowledgeable, and certified addiction professionals. Therefore, you can get all the assistance you need as you work on your recovery.

These facilities also function somewhat like sober living homes - except that you will be supervised more intensively to make certain that you don't relapse and you undergo more intensive therapy and counseling.

Although long-term rehabilitation programs range from residential facilities to hospital settings, they will all offer a safe and supportive atmosphere where you can concentrate on your recovery.

These facilities have also been evolving and many will provide various methods of substance abuse treatment. For instance, you may be able to enroll in a long term drug rehab center that also incorporates holistic methods of addiction rehabilitation, faith-based rehabilitation, and several other methods of treatment.

The programs may also offer experiential treatment therapies, relaxation therapy, improved nutrition, physical exercise, and yoga or other eastern meditative disciplines to accelerate your recovery while ensuring that you know how to control your addiction compulsions and overcome any triggers you may have to use drugs. These treatment services could additionally allow you to continue recovering spiritually, emotionally, physically, and mentally - typically resulting in better outcomes.

Also, the facility can provide you with other relapse prevention methods to ensure that you avoid relapse after the rehab is complete. For example, they might help you develop new occupational skills, better learn how to manage your money and deal with your finances, teach you how to succeed at job interviews, and show you how to improve your hygiene, cleanliness, and physical appearance.

Since substance abuse influences all facets of your life, it is essential that you handle every aspect in regards to your substance abuse - in addition to the physical aspect of addiction.

While working to make sure that addiction no longer has any significance in your life, therefore, long-term alcohol and drug rehabs in Bend, Texas also work to treat the psychological attributes of addiction. This is why they provide diverse types of therapy and counseling.

The length of the rehab program will be different from one patient to the next determined by various factors. These factors include the severity and duration of your addiction, the types of drugs you abused, as well as whether or not you may have a dual diagnosis or a co-occurring mental health condition arising from or intensified by your drug use.

Benefits of Long-Term Drug Abuse Treatment

Recent studies have demonstrated that addicts who spend longer in a rehabilitation center typically have higher rates of success. Therefore, the longer you stay in the rehab program, the easier it will be for you to concentrate on recovery.

Long term drug treatment in Bend can also give you the resources to learn how to support your sobriety and manage any triggers that you might encounter in your fight against addiction.

Initially, the recovery program will work on physical detoxification. This will allow you to clear your mind and body of all drug and alcohol (as well as the leftover toxins) that you were ingesting.

After that, you will spend the rest of the time in rehabilitation addressing all the underlying causes of your addiction. Therefore, this type of rehab will ensure that you are in a better position to work on all the people, places, and things that caused you to using drugs in the first place. During the process, long-term rehabilitation will teach you other life skills and coping skills that you can utilize to prevent yourself from reverting.

Overall, long-term substance abuse treatment is the most successful form of treatment especially if you have a long-standing severe addiction and need more intensive treatment to resolve your addiction.

Christian Farms-Treehouse, Inc. (CFTH) began in 1970 as a Bible based work-study program for men. In 1978, we expanded to include a separate location for women. In 2008, CFTH consolidated to one campus. Our residential based treatment center provides a therapeutic program using a standard 12-step program and Christian principles. Our one year success rate continues to be over 72%. CFTH is licensed with the Texas Department of State Health Services. We are a non-profit corporation governed by a volunteer board of directors.
